9 June 1905 | A Dutch Jew, Eliazar Blok, was born in The Hague. A musician.

On 20 January 1944 he was transferred from Westerbork to Theresienstadt Ghetto, and on 28 September 1944 deported to #Auschwitz. He perished in Dachau in April 1945.

10 June 1881 | Polish Jew Teodor Ryder was born in a village of Piotrków. Conductor & pianist. He sturied at the Darmstad Conservatory. Conductor of the Lodz Symphony Orchestra.

In 1944 he was deported from Litzmanndstadt ghetto to #Auschwitz & murdered.

8 June 1943 | A transport of 880 Jews deported from the ghetto from Thessaloniki in German-occupied Greece arrived at #Auschwitz.

After the arrival selection 220 men and 88 women were registered in the camp The remaining 572 people were murdered in a gas chamber.

3 June 1942 | 58 prisoners - Polish priests and monks - were transferred to Dachau concentration camp. It was the third and the last transport of clergy from Auschwitz to Dachau.

At least 464 priests, seminarians & monks, as well as 35 nuns, were imprisoned at #Auschwitz. In our podcast, Teresa Wontor Cichy from our Research Center, talks about the fate of Christian clergy & religious life in the camp. https://youtu.be/pS0LQoQ4YLk

24 May 1943 | SS-Hauptsturmführer Josef Mengele received his transfer order to the #Auschwitz concentration camp. he began his service there on May 30 as he became the chief physician of the Zigeunerlager (sector for Sinti and Roma) at Auschwitz II-Birkenau.

23 May 1913 | French Jew of Argentinian origin, Sigismond Syskind, was born in Buenos Aires. In 1921 he came to France.

He was deported to #Auschwitz on 20 May 1944. Later he was transferred to Sachsenhausen, Flossenbürg and & Dresden where he died of dysentery on 7 April 1945.

23 May 1944 | A transport of 1,200 French Jews arrived at #Auschwitz from Drancy. After the selection, 221 men & 247 women were registered in the camp.

The remaining 723 people were murdered in gas chambers. Among them was Harriet Nordmann. She was almost 3 years old.

19 May 1881 | Jewish man, Bernard Berenhaut, was born in Cracow (then Austro-Hungary). A merchant. He moved to Berlin and in 1939 fled to Norway.

He arrived at #Auschwitz on 1 December 1942 and was murdered in a gas chamber after arrival selection.
